Stopping a Mars mission from messing with the mind – Axios

Science News

  1. Stopping a Mars mission from messing with the mind  Axios
  2. Mars mission off? Expert warns experts to fix Earth before leaving  Express.co.uk
  3. NASA asteroid tracker: A large rock is hurtling towards Earth at 54,000MPH  Express.co.uk
  4. View full coverage on Google News

Source: Science News